article thumbnail

The labor report gives the Fed a clear pathway to land the plane

Housing Wire

Today’s jobs report beat estimates , but the internals show the labor market is softening, as the Federal Reserve wants. The data shows that wage growth is cooling down and the job opening quits rate is below pre-COVID-19 levels. This bodes well for those hoping to see a soft landing, and for those hoping for lower mortgage rates. article thumbnail

Opinion: No benefit to home sellers is worth sacrificing first-time homebuyers

Housing Wire

The recent settlement involving the National Association of Realtors and major real estate firms revolves around the practice of “broker cooperation,” where agents representing sellers share commissions with agents representing buyers. Proponents of the lawsuits argue that this customary practice inflates commissions , and believe that buyers and sellers should pay their agent representation separately.

article thumbnail

Midwest housing markets good for first-time homebuyers: Zillow

Housing Wire

The number of first-time homebuyers made up 32% of all buyers in 2023, according to a report released by the National Association of Realtors. Millennials comprised 75% of this demographic, with older millennials and Generation X (ages 44 to 58) accounting for 44% and 24% of first-time buyers. Against that backdrop, Zillow identified prime markets for first-time homebuyers , and half of them were nestled in the Midwest.

article thumbnail

Zillow or CoStar? NAR settlement terms could determine a winner

Housing Wire

Real estate listing giants Zillow and CoStar are currently embattled in a fight for listing portal supremacy. The battle began heating up in September 2023 when CoStar’s residential real estate platform Homes.com surpassed 100 million unique monthly visitors, becoming the second most popular listing portal behind Zillow.
